A triangle has side lengths of 13, 9, and 5. Is the triangle a right triangle? Explain.

2Points
Use complete sentences in your explanation.

Hint: Pythagorean Theorem: a^2+ b^2 = c^2

Answers

Answer 1

Answer: This triangle is not a right triangle

Step-by-step explanation:

In a right triangle, the hypotenuse(c) is always the longest side and a and b are the shorter sides.  Thus, 5^2+9^2=13^2.  Simplify this to get 25+81=169, then 106=169.  Because 106 does not equal 169, it is not a right triangle.

I will give brainliest!! THERE IS NO OTHER INFORMATION GIVEN!! In ⊙O, chord XY is 8 cm long and is 10 cm from O. What is the radius ⊙O?

Answers

Answer:

radius ≈ 10.77 cm

Step-by-step explanation:

The segment from the centre O to the chord is a perpendicular bisector.

Thus 2 right triangles are formed with legs 10 cm and 4 cm ( half of XY )

The radius r is the hypotenuse.

Using Pythagoras' identity, then

r² = 4² + 10² = 16 + 100 = 116 ( take the square root of both sides )

r = [tex]\sqrt{116}[/tex] ≈ 10.77 cm ( to 2 dec. places )

Match each correlation coefficient, r, to its description.
weak negative
correlation
weak positive
correlation
strong positive
correlation

strong negative
correlation
r = −0.83
arrowRight
r = −0.08
arrowRight
r = 0.96
arrowRight
r = 0.06
arrowRight

Answers

Answer:

r = -0.83

strong negative correlation

r = -0.08

weak negative correlation

r = 0.96

strong positive correlation

r = 0.06

weak positive correlation

Step-by-step explanation:

In this question, what we are expected to do is to match the values of the correlation given with the type of correlation in which the values are.

When we talk of correlation, we are simply referring to the extent of agreement between the values in the data field.

Correlation has a value between -1 and +1, meaning it could be negative or positive.

Values closer to the extremes i.e (-1 or +1) indicates strong correlation while values farther away, i.e closer to zero indicates a weak relationship.

Let’s answer the questions specifically now:

r = -0.83

This is closer to -1 and it indicates a strong negative correlation

r = -0.08

This indicates a weak negative correlation as it is closer to zero and farther away form -1

r = 0.96

This indicates a strong positive correlation

r = 0.06

This indicates a weak positive correlation
